The Marine Lubricant market is an important part of the Shipbuilding and Ship Parts industry. It is used to lubricate and protect the various components of ships, such as engines, pumps, and other machinery. Marine lubricants are designed to withstand the harsh conditions of the marine environment, including extreme temperatures, high pressures, and corrosive saltwater. They also help to reduce friction and wear, and improve the efficiency of the ship's machinery.
The Marine Lubricant market is highly competitive, with a wide range of products available from various manufacturers. Companies in the market include Shell, ExxonMobil, Chevron, Total, BP, and FUCHS. Show Less Read more
